What Is a Crypto Online Casino?
A crypto online casino is an internet‑based g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rency deposits, wagers, and payments solely (or mainly) in digital properties. While the game library might mirror that of a standard online casino-- slots, table games, live dealership titles, poker, and sports betting-- the payment layer runs on a blockchain. Transactions are tape-recorded on a public journal, using openness, faster settlement times, and lower charges compared to credit‑card or bank‑transfer paths.
